Pocket Change...
1910 cents are relatively few in number as were the number of dies used to crete them. So far no noticeable doubled dies have been reported, but there are a couple of relatively exciting RPMs for the S mint cents. obverse - A couple of nice RPMs are all there is to report for this year reverse - Nothing known to report for the reverse of any 1910 cent other than the possibility of an error showing a faint remnant of a VDB near the center lower rim (where the VDB would have been expected on 1909 cents). The existence of this anomaly has not been confirmed.

the proof...
Proof cents are very scarce this year. No known variety for any 1910 proof cent has been reported. obverse - No varieties are known for 1910 proof cents. There is, however, some slight chance that a proof could surface and be sold as a normal business strike cent, so be watchful for the mottled appearance of the matte proofs on sharply struck higher grade specimens. reverse - same as for the obverse.

1910S-1MM-001
| S/S/S SOUTHEAST & TILTED
CONECA: RPM-001 Crawford: unknown
Wexler: WRPM-001 FS#: 501 This RPM is a very strong one, showing very well in 10X magnification. High grade specimens are known and usually command a modest premium over the value of a normal 1910S cent for the grade.

1910S-1MM-002
| S/S NORTH
CONECA: RPM-002 Crawford: unknown
Wexler: WRPM-002 FS#: 502 A nice north spread shows on this variety. This RPM is a little less common than 1910S-1MM-001 and commands a bit more of a premium over the value of a normal 1910S cent. Old CPG#12.7
